It looks like the first campaign speech for Hillary Clinton will arrive well before her announcement to run. The New York Times is reporting that the presumptive presidential candidate will defend herself against accusations that she improperly conducted state business from a private email account. As part of a plan to double revenue by 2019, Starbucks has announced it will begin mobile ordering capability next week around the Seattle area.  The company hopes to decrease wait times, as well as attract customers to its mobile ecosystem.
